Commercial Framing in Kansas City, KS

Commercial framing services involve the construction and installation of the structural framework for various types of commercial buildings, such as retail stores, office complexes, warehouses, and industrial facilities. This service includes the assembly of wall frames, floor systems, and roof structures using materials like wood, steel, or metal studs. Property owners typically request framing services during new construction projects or renovations to ensure the building’s skeleton is properly designed and securely erected to support the entire structure.

Before requesting commercial framing, property owners should understand the scope of the project, including the building size, design specifications, and materials preferred. It is also important to consider any local building codes or regulations that may impact the framing process. Clarifying project timelines, access requirements, and coordination with other construction trades helps ensure the framing work aligns with overall project goals. Proper planning and communication can contribute to a smooth construction process and a durable, long-lasting structure.

Common Commercial Framing Jobs

Commercial framing involves constructing the structural framework for retail, office, and industrial buildings.

Interior framing includes installing walls, partitions, and ceilings to define interior spaces.

Exterior framing provides the support for building facades, including walls and roofing structures.

Steel framing offers a durable option for large commercial projects requiring strength and longevity.

Wood framing is commonly used for smaller commercial buildings and interior partitions.

Custom framing solutions can be tailored to meet specific architectural designs and building codes.

Commercial Framing Questions

What types of projects require commercial framing services? Commercial framing is used for constructing walls, partitions, and structural supports in new buildings or renovations of offices, retail spaces, and warehouses.

What materials are commonly used in commercial framing? Steel and wood are the most common materials, chosen based on the project requirements and building design.

How does commercial framing differ from residential framing? Commercial framing often involves larger structures, heavier materials, and adherence to different building codes compared to residential projects.

What should property owners consider when planning commercial framing? It’s important to evaluate the building’s purpose, load requirements, and the timeline for construction to ensure proper framing design and materials are used.
